it’s only pothunting if they win the pot.

Since many other comments are comparing this flux of small boats to the Georgia Tech pothunting of the 2010s, that program did not lack varsity boat movers, but chose to take up the small boat categories to eat up some Ws.

Since you highlight MSU men as an example, check the stats, only 4 out of the 16 varsity rowers they’re fielding this year competed at ACRAs in a varsity category at ACRAs last year. That indicator alone should tell you that there may be a big experience gap (I.e. skill gap) in that program, plus with nearly as many novs competing as varsity this program is clearly in a growth phase. The amalgamation of experience gaps and large pool of underclassmen raise some complicated team dynamics to navigate in order to make fast boats while mitigating the damage that any developing oarsmen might wreck on a crew.

Again, any of those programs could be pothunting, but its only pothunting if they win, and they instead could just have a bunch of anchors instead of boat movers, and we’ll figure that out in 10 days.

The future is drones. Assuming you row in an area away from no-fly zones, a drone with a camera (some will just hold your phone and record) provides two things that are critical for any coach:

  1. The ability to see the crew from literally all angles, providing the coach the ability to evaluate technical, physical, and rigging questions on a whim that they might not otherwise be able to see from the launch.
